Farmington Hotel held in contempt by the Legislature for ignoring appearance invitation

Written by Wholquoi Yeahgar -yeahgarwholquoi2rocketmail.com

Monrovia, Liberia– The House of Representatives has held in contempt authorities of the Farmington Hotel for grossly ignoring an appearance invitation.

The House on Tuesday cited authorities of Farmington Hotel based on a communication from Representative Ivar Jones alleging bad labor practices against local employees of the entity.

But the Hotel’s Management in a communication to that august body Thursday unsigned by an administrator noted that the General Manager had left the country to attend to some family issues.

The Hotel’s communication requested reappearance in April upon the arrival of the General Manager.

Following the reading of said communication, the House of Representatives in a motion by Lofa County District 3 Representative Clarence Massaquoi angrily termed the position of the Hotel as gross disrespect to that body.
